
Yugoslav National Team
The Yugoslav National Team was the official soccer team representing Yugoslavia, a country in Southeast Europe that existed until the early 2000s. Comprising players from the various republics within Yugoslavia, the team competed internationally in tournaments like the FIFA World Cup and UEFA European Championship. Known for technical skill and creative play, Yugoslavia's team had a strong football tradition, producing many talented athletes over the years. After Yugoslavia's dissolution in the 1990s, the successor states formed their own national teams.
